We tend to think spiritual growth means becoming someone wiser, calmer, more elevated. But over time, I’ve realized it’s really a softening — a letting go of needing to be anyone at all. This quote always reminds me that the most genuine awakening is profoundly ordinary.

🕊”Do not think that enlightenment is going to make you special, it’s not. If you feel special in any way, then enlightenment has not occurred. I meet a lot of people who think they are enlightened and awake simply because they have had a very moving spiritual experience. They wear their enlightenment on their sleeve like a badge of honour. They sit among friends and talk about how awake they are while sipping coffee at a cafe. The funny thing about enlightenment is that when it is authentic, there is no one to claim it. Enlightenment is very ordinary; it is nothing special. Rather than making you more special, it is going to make you less special. It plants you right in the centre of a wonderful humility and innocence. Everyone else may or may not call you enlightened, but when you are enlightened the whole notion of enlightenment and someone who is enlightened is a big joke. I use the word enlightenment all the time; not to point you toward it but to point you beyond it. Do not get stuck in enlightenment.”(Adyashanti)

Today we explored spaciousness — the way breath expands within us, the way awareness widens when we soften our grip on effort.
In those quiet moments at the end of class, when body and mind dissolve into stillness, we may catch a glimpse of moksha — inner freedom.

Moksha doesn’t mean escaping life, but rather being fully present within it — unbound by our stories, our fears, or our striving. Through practice, we learn to return again and again to that vast inner sky where nothing is missing and nothing is held too tightly.
